What is the DD 350 Report for FA8771-04-D-0004?
The DD 350 Report is a government form utilized for reporting contract information to the U.S. Department of Defense. Its primary purpose is to gather vital details about contractors involved in defense contracting, ensuring transparency and accountability. The report collects essential information, including contractor details, financial specifics, and the nature of the contract.
To provide clarity and enhance efficiency, the DD 350 Report requires inputs such as the contracting office, contractor name, type of contract, and relevant financial data. This comprehensive form plays a crucial role in maintaining the integrity of defense contracts and is mandated for use in government contracting processes.

Field-by-Field Instructions for the DD 350 Report
Completing the DD 350 Report requires attention to detail in each field. Below is an overview of critical fields to fill out:
-
Type of Report: Specify the nature of the report you are submitting.
-
Report Number: Enter the unique identification number assigned to this report.
-
Contract Number: Provide the specific number associated with the contract.
-
Contractor Name/Division: Clearly state the name of the contractor or relevant division.
Ensuring accuracy and completeness in each of these fields is crucial for the integrity of the report.
